Output 66e73b0b784e7c859a380cd93d964d8073b60aaffcefd892d60d655a549b7b64:0

value
740000
script pubkey
OP_0 OP_PUSHBYTES_20 270d1585e9d76b98f14776bd600e62ca477bfb7a
address
bc1qyux3tp0f6a4e3u28w67kqrnzefrhh7m6g3ng6d
transaction
66e73b0b784e7c859a380cd93d964d8073b60aaffcefd892d60d655a549b7b64
confirmations
67616
spent
true